How valuable are the U.S. Navy's riverine craft to littoral operations?

Ahead of his presentation on operational experiences with counter-piracy in the Gulf at the Fast Interception and Riverine conference from 9 - 11 February 2015 in London, Captain Jeffrey McCauley, NAVCENT, 5th Fleet US CENTCOM, spoke to Defence IQ about a number of issues, including Commander Task Force 56 and the importance of riverine craft.
